CE RD PHG 250 0604 Copyright 2010 by Wurth 07 0225 Application The material is applied in a liquid state directly onto an oil and dust free surface The cleaner the surface the stronger the bond These adhesives cure in an anaerobic environment ie the adhesive only hardens where it is not exposed to oxygen For that reason the containers are only approx 34 full A t the same time the curing speed is also influenced by the catalytic effect of metal as well as the width of the gap The more passive the material and the wider the gap the slower the adhesive will cure P assive materials nickel zinc tin precious metals aluminum with a low Cu andor manganese content highalloy steel oxide or chromate layers plastics glass and ceramic materials Active materials steel brass bronze copper aluminum Cu content higher than1 For cleaning and degreasing we recom mend Brake Cleaner Art No 8939105 Caution The following synthetic materials may be damaged after lengthy reaction times ABS Celluloid Polystyrole Polycarbonate Makrolon PMMA Plexiglass Polysulfone SAN Luran Tyril Vinidur Vulcanized Fiber and enamelled surfaces We generally recommend that you perform your own tests Notes Product is applied in a liquid state directly to the parts and hardens after assembly into a viscoplastic synthetic material This completely fills the gap protecting sealed parts from corrosion A 100 tight seal is achieved Resistance The product is resistant to a wide variety of lyes gases solvents oils and fuels Areas of application Automotive metal construction and tool making ship building machine and engine building electrical and electronic engineering
